package covers1624.powerconverters.charge;
import cofh.api.energy.IEnergyContainerItem;
import covers1624.powerconverters.api.charge.IChargeHandler;
import covers1624.powerconverters.api.registry.PowerSystemRegistry;
import covers1624.powerconverters.init.PowerSystems;
import net.minecraft.item.ItemStack;
public class ChargeHandlerRedstoneFlux implements IChargeHandler {
public PowerSystemRegistry.PowerSystem getPowerSystem() {
return PowerSystems.powerSystemRedstoneFlux;
}
public boolean canHandle(ItemStack stack) {
return stack != null && stack.getItem() instanceof IEnergyContainerItem;
}
public double charge(ItemStack stack, double energyInput) {
double RF = energyInput / (double) this.getPowerSystem().getScaleAmmount();
RF -= (double) ((IEnergyContainerItem) stack.getItem())
.receiveEnergy(stack, (int) RF, false);
return RF * (double) this.getPowerSystem().getScaleAmmount();
}
public double discharge(ItemStack stack, double energyRequest) {
IEnergyContainerItem cell = (IEnergyContainerItem) stack.getItem();
return (double
) (cell.extractEnergy(
stack,
(int) (energyRequest / (double) this.getPowerSystem().getScaleAmmount()),
false
)
* this.getPowerSystem().getScaleAmmount());
}
public String name() {
return "Redstone Flux";
}
public boolean isItemCharged(ItemStack stack) {
if (this.canHandle(stack)) {
IEnergyContainerItem item = (IEnergyContainerItem) stack.getItem();
if (item.getEnergyStored(stack) == item.getMaxEnergyStored(stack)) {
return true;
}
}
return false;
}
}
